Output 57ea0481c0379358f8c8f64fe5cd2d3ffc622a7b991534cb8f0f8d38cac59c2e:3

value
22291
script pubkey
OP_HASH160 OP_PUSHBYTES_20 638db063014a699cf1e847ef5e12786904399d99 OP_EQUAL
address
3AmQZG2xL6w1uYEUuNtWUg7TLmxCVJaYsL
transaction
57ea0481c0379358f8c8f64fe5cd2d3ffc622a7b991534cb8f0f8d38cac59c2e
spent
true